Pros

The company offers great benefits and perks, and the overall work culture can be fun and social. When I first joined, it felt like a positive place to work and a good environment to learn. It’s a solid company to start your career, especially if you’re early on and want exposure to the role.

Kontras

While the experience started off strong, there was very little room for growth long term. Opportunities were not distributed equally across the team, and favoritism was noticeable at times. The same individuals were consistently praised for simply doing their jobs, while others’ contributions were rarely acknowledged. The team culture could feel very cliquey, and if you weren’t part of the “favorites,” it was difficult to be recognized or considered for new opportunities. Although leadership often spoke about internal growth and mobility, in reality those opportunities felt extremely limited. Once you’re placed on a team, it’s very hard to move into something new or grow beyond that role. This is a good place to start your career and gain experience, but not a place I would recommend staying long term. If you’re looking for growth, development, and mobility within the company, you may find yourself feeling stuck.
